OBJECTIVE: We describe a novel didactic program to prepare mid-level residents for the operative complexities of the transplant surgery rotation. DESIGN: A faculty led dry and wet lab experience was held for all residents returning to clinical rotations from a 2-year research experience. Residents were provided instructional video prior to the dry lab and instructed through both labs by transplant faculty and fellows. The culmination of the program entailed a porcine renal autotransplantation. SETTING: The University of Cincinnati, Department of Surgery, Cincinnati, OH. PARTICIPANTS: Incoming third year general surgery residents returning to clinical rotations from a 2-year research experience. RESULTS: This lab was well received by residents and faculty and increased confidence in residents. CONCLUSIONS: This program increased confidence in complex operations seen on the transplant surgery rotation and can be replicated in a cost-effective manner.

OBJECTIVE: The operative experience of today's general surgery resident has changed, but little is known about the modern experience as nonprimary surgeon. We set out to explore changes in the operative experience of general surgery residents as first assistant (FA) and teaching assistant (TA). DESIGN, SETTING, AND PARTICIPANTS: This is a review of ACGME national operative log reports from 1990 to 2018. TA and FA cases were analyzed. Statistical analysis was performed using polynomial regression analysis and Kruskal-Wallis test. Statistical significance was set at p < 0.05. RESULTS: 30,260 individuals completed general surgery residency during the study period with medians of 951 (interquartile range: 929-974) total major, 63 (31-184) FA, and 32 (25-48) TA cases. As a proportion of total cases completed, FA cases decreased from 21.8% of the total operative experience in 1990 to 2.5% in 2018, and TA cases declined from 7.4% of the total operative experience in 1990 to 3.5% in 2018. Regression modeling demonstrated that both operative roles decreased over time, but at a progressively decreasing rate, with FA cases reaching a "floor" around 2010 and TA cases reaching a "breakpoint" in 2008 at which time operative volume rebounded and began to increase. Among the core general surgery domains of abdomen and alimentary tract, compositional analysis revealed a decrease across each of the 11 operative subcategories (all p < 0.05) for FA, and for TA, a decrease in 6 of the 11 operative subcategories (stomach, small intestine, large intestine, anorectal, hernia, and biliary, all p < 0.05). CONCLUSIONS: Over the past 3 decades, the resident operative experience as nonprimary surgeon has decreased dramatically, with today's residents graduating with fewer FA and TA cases. As surgical training has traditionally relied heavily on an apprenticeship model for learning technical skills, it is essential that surgical educators recognize and rectify these trends.

BACKGROUND AND AIM: The purpose of the present study was to determine the effects of interleukin-37 (IL-37) on liver cells and on liver inflammation induced by hepatic ischemia/reperfusion (I/R). METHODS: Mice were subjected to I/R. Some mice received recombinant IL-37 (IL-37) at the time of reperfusion. Serum levels of alanine aminotransferase, and liver myeloperoxidase content were assessed. Serum and liver tumor necrosis factor-α (TNF-α), macrophage inflammatory protein-2 (MIP-2) and keratinocyte chemokine (KC) were also assessed. Hepatic reactive oxygen species (ROS) levels were assessed. For in vitro experiments, isolated hepatocytes and Kupffer cells were treated with IL-37 and inflammatory stimulants. Cytokine and chemokine production by these cells were assessed. Primary hepatocytes underwent induced cell injury and were treated with IL-37 concurrently. Hepatocyte cytotoxicity and Bcl-2 expression were determined. Isolated neutrophils were treated with TNF-α and IL-37 and neutrophil activation and respiratory burst were assessed. RESULTS: IL-37 reduced hepatocyte injury and neutrophil accumulation in the liver after I/R. These effects were accompanied by reduced serum levels of TNF-α and MIP-2 and hepatic ROS levels. IL-37 significantly reduced MIP-2 and KC productions from lipopolysaccharide-stimulated hepatocytes and Kupffer cells. IL-37 significantly reduced cell death and increased Bcl-2 expression in hepatocytes. IL-37 significantly suppressed TNF-α-induced neutrophil activation. CONCLUSIONS: IL-37 is protective against hepatic I/R injury. These effects are related to the ability of IL-37 to reduce proinflammatory cytokine and chemokine production by hepatocytes and Kupffer cells as well as having a direct protective effect on hepatocytes. In addition, IL-37 contributes to reduce liver injury through suppression of neutrophil activity.
